Pat McAfee Shares What He Has Heard About Tom Brady Throughout the Raiders Interview Process

It’s no secret that Raiders minority owner Tom Brady has been very involved in the process of finding the next GM and head coach in Las Vegas, but according to Pat McAfee, Brady it literally running the show in Vegas right now.

McAfee said Brady has been “very active” and running the interviews with prospective general managers and coaches.

“It’s a fluid situation, but what we’re being told and hearing out of Las Vegas is that Tom Brady is running that ship,” McAfee said on his Wednesday show. “This isn’t like Tom Brady’s just a fly on the wall. This isn’t like ‘Oh, how does this go?’ What we’re being is that Tom Brady is the one asking the questions; Tom Brady is the one kind of conducting the interviews; Tom Brady is the one that is figuring out what’s the right way and what’s wrong.”

Brady was on The Herd with Colin Cowherd on Wednesday and he talked about how he is still learning his new role in Las Vegas.

He said it has been a “collaborate effort” among the Raiders ownership group and decision-makers in the organization. He didn’t say it, but it is believed Brady is also leaning heavily on fellow minority owner Richard Seymour in the process.

As of Thursday morning, there has only been one significant hire with Brady in the building and that was GM John Spytek, who was announced on Wednesday.

Spytek has a relationship with Brady that goes all the way back to their time as teammates at the University of Michigan, and he had been a front runner for the job since former GM Tom Telesco was fired on January 9.

The timing of Spytek’s hiring suggests Brady and company were open to the idea of Ben Johnson bringing his own GM to Las Vegas, but that idea fell apart when Johnson chose the Bears over the Raiders on Monday.

It’s been three days since Johnson announced his decision to go to Chicago, and the longer the hiring process plays out in Las Vegas, it’s looking like the decision-makers in the Raiders’ building are having trouble coming to a consensus on their no. 2 option.

Every indication is that Pete Carroll is the next coach in line, but the Raiders clearly have some level of reservation around Carroll as the process continues to drag out.

Carroll has been getting the most attention for the Raiders’ HC job, but Sports Illustrated’s Albert Breer says there’s another familiar name for Raider fans to keep an eye on.

“I think Tom Brady’s personal relationships are a factor here,” Breer said on the Rich Eisen Show. “One thing that I did hear was not to rule out was not to rule out Pete Carroll or Steve Spagnuolo because Brady has respect for them having gone up against them.”
